Single t-Quark Productions via Flavor-Changing Processes in Topcolor-Assisted Technicolor Model at Hadron Colliders
Authors:XU Wen-Na WANG Xue-Lei XIAO Zhen-Jun
Institution:1. Department of Physics and Institute of Theoretical Physics, Nanjing Normal University, Nanjing 210097, China ;2. College of Physics and Information Engineering, Henan Normal University, Xinxiang 453007, China
Abstract:In the framework of topcolor-assisted technicolor (TC2) model, there exist tree-level flavor-changing (FC) couplings, which can result in the loop-level FC coupling tcg. Such tcg coupling can contribute significant clues at the forthcoming Large Hadron Collider (LHC) experiments. In this paper, based on the TC2 model, we study some single t-quark production processes involving tcg coupling at the Tevatron and LHC: pp(pp)→ tq (q=u,d,s),tg. We calculate the cross sections of these processes. The results show that the cross sections at the Tevatron are too small to observe the signal, but at the LHC it can reach a few pb. With the high luminosity, the LHC has considerable capability to find the single t-quark signal produced via some FC processes involving coupling tcg. On the other hand, these processes can also provide some valuable information of the coupling tcg with detailed study of the processes and furthermore provide the reliable evidence to test the TC2 model.
Keywords:topcolor-assisted technicolor model  flavor-changing couplings  hadron colliders  electroweak symmetry breaking
